Coffee - Wikipedia Coffee is a beverage brewed from roasted, ground coffee beans Darkly colored, bitter, and slightly acidic, coffee has a stimulating effect on humans, primarily due to its caffeine content, but decaffeinated coffee is also commercially available There are also various coffee substitutes

Coffee -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Making coffee is called brewing coffee There are several different ways that coffee can be brewed Coffee contains a number of useful nutrients, including riboflavin, niacin, magnesium, potassium, and various phenolic compounds, or antioxidants There are two main types of coffee plants: c offea arabica and c offea robusta

Coffee and health: What does the research say? - Mayo Clinic Drinking coffee can be healthy For example, studies find that coffee drinkers have a lower risk of death from any cause compared to people who don't drink coffee The benefits of coffee depend on things like how much you drink, your age, being biologically male or female, medicine you take, and even your genes
